What does it mean to be accredited?
When the service or program you choose is CARF-accredited, it means
your provider has passed an in-depth review of its services.
It is your assurance that the provider meets rigorous CARF guidelines
for service and quality -- a qualified endorsement that your
provider conforms to nationally and internationally recognized
service standards and is focused on delivering the most favorable
results for you.
A hallmark of quality
After an organization applies for accreditation of its services
or programs, CARF sends professionals in the field to conduct
an on-site survey to determine the degree to which the organization
meets the standards. CARF surveyors also consult with staff members
and offer suggestions for improving the quality of services.
CARF-accredited programs and services have demonstrated that they
substantially meet internationally recognized standards. CARF accreditation
means that you can be confident that an organization has made a
commitment to continually enhance the quality of its services and
programs and its focus on consumer satisfaction.
